The Clermont Exchange, located at 639 8th Street, houses multiple shops, all located under the same roof.

One Utopia: This wonderful stop serves all plant-based drinks and foods including delicious lattes, mushroom matcha, kava, coffees, blue majik, chicory, coconut and flavored waters. This is their first drink specialty location, while they do have two other successful locations in Winter Garden and Clermont. One Utopia is the creation of Tina Aldrich. Teamont of Clermont: Wow! Awesome! Juliana Green and her family have launched Teamont of Clermont to her true love and passion for boba teas. Always served cold in plentiful 16 and 24 ounce sizes, they also offer an assortment of milk teas, fruit tea mixers, slush drinks. They even offer purely vegan drinks, tiger milk tea and vanilla with a brown sugar swirl. Options include tapioca or popping boba pearls. The most popular flavors are guava, lychee, passion fruit, pineapple, coconut, raspberry, watermelon, kiwi, mango, peach, pomegranate, and strawberry. Whistle Stop Bakery: Owned and lovingly baked by Shannon Leigh, Whistle Stop Bakery offers you freshly baked cookies, cakes, old fashioned whoopie pies, brownies, macaroons and a complete array of desserts. She uses local sources for her ingredients, using natural fruits and reduced or ‘old fashioned’ sugar baking techniques. She shares something fresh and new every week! Sweet Cups Chef: Here you will find a dessert shop with an assortment of delicious refrigerated cheese cakes in a mason jar. Amy and Frank Anastasia of Clermont have opened this store to share some great desserts and treats with you. They offer blueberry bliss, chocolate hazelnut, just peachy and all fresh fruit cheese cakes. They also offer a perfectly plain cheesecake in a jar with a Keto Diet option. They started with Farmer’s Market booths here in the Clermont and Lake County area, before it progressed into a delivery and a storefront business. Carriage & Key Antiques: Walton Cobb opened his first antique shop with plenty of eclectic options from typewriters, lamps, old dishware, glassware, radios and sewing machines to some very unusual and unique antique items. Cobb scours the countryside searching far and wide for estate sales and opportunities to bring you collectibles from outside of the South Lake area. Sweet Finish Kettle Corn: One of our Downtown Clermont event favorites has been brought to this new storefront by Matt Aldi of Clermont. He offers a variety of wonderfully seasoned popcorns in 4 sweetened flavors throughout the year including garlic parmesan, cheddar, jalapeno and white cheddar. He also shares special holiday flavors like white chocolate pumpkin spice for Thanksgiving and white chocolate peppermint for the year-end holidays. Nery’s Jewelry Box: Nereida Gonzalez of Clermont opened a fabulous suite of fine jewelry to match any outfit and for any special occasion. Nery specializes in providing you with very unique and distinctly different stainless steel, silver and gold-plated fashion jewelry. While Nery creates some of the jewelry herself, she also imports exotic jewelry designs from 30 different countries.  ZiZi’s Gourmet Foods: Frank and Chiarina Gucciardo have launched this exciting new boutique food shop with everything brought in from ‘New York’ and Italy. This includes fresh Bronx, New York bagels, Kaiser rolls, cannoli’s and assorted baked goods. They regularly feature an assortment of imported sweet and hot Italian sausages and meatballs. Comic Controllers: Locally owned by Jessie and Alex Weissman, this boutique shop offers an array of unique home video game control devices. Each one is custom-made and hand-painted based upon the various superheroes, comics and gaming designs. Orchid’s By Charlene: Charlene Ching-Bituin has launched her delightful floral shop boutique with local and imported floral arrangements that she always arranges herself. She has been sharing and selling an array of uncommon orchids here in South Lake since 2017. Decorative arrangements are priced to fit any budget.
